EXPERIMENTS ON SEAWEED BED CREATION TECHNOLOGY USING SUBSTRATES WITH DIFFERENT MATERIALS AND SHAPES AND ESTIMATION OF THE AMOUNT OF CARBON DIOXIDE TAKEN IN BY SEAWEEDS

Abstract

 In this study, we devised materials and shapes of concrete blocks to address multiple factors of rocky-shore denudation and conducted verification experiments in actual sea areas. In addition, the 2 absorption amount of seaweeds growing on the test blocks were estimated.As a result, it was confirmed that seaweeds such as kelp thrived better in the square test blocks contained with amino acids than in the conventional blocks and that seaweeds continued to thrive and diverse aquatic organisms appeared in the plate test blocks impregnated with amino acids.The 2 absorption amount of the square test blocks was 7.995 t-2/ha/year, 1.125 t-2/ha/year has estimated for the board-type test block. Future work will require additional correction of data through ongoing research and verification of the effects of technologies with different characteristics, either alone or in combination.
